    We will be staying in the Animal Kingdom Lodge. I was wondering how long will it take to Magic Kingdom and what is the best route to take? Thanks!

    You can take a Disney bus from the Animal Kingdom Lodge directly to the Magic Kingdom.  Travel time is approximately 20 - 25 minutes. Keep in mind that you'll also need to budget in time to wait on the bus (typically 20 minutes at the most).

    There are a few unofficial Disney sites that I've seen provide directions & travel time between Disney properties. One that I've found to be very helpful is www.ourlaughingplace.com. Once you reach their site, click on Transportation Wizard in the top right corner of their homepage.

    From there it will give you a drop down menu of where you're traveling from and your destination. Sometimes the options they list aren't the only options but it will give a really good point of reference to get started.

    If you are not renting a car and relying solely on Disney transportation, make sure you allow yourself plenty of time for any Advanced Dining Reservations (ADRs) or any other reservations. If you see that you are running a bit behind & your ADR isn't located near you, taking a taxi may be a good option.

    Once you're on property, you can always confirm with the concierge at your resort that your plan of action is the most current and will get you there in a timely manner.
